The Effect of Humidity on Paint Drying Time



You're possibly questioning how the moisture outside can affect your paint project, well let me inform you, it can really decrease the drying time of your paint!

When the air is humid, it is saturated with wetness, and this can trigger your paint to take a lot longer to dry than it would certainly in a drier environment. This is since the water in the paint needs to vaporize in order for the paint to dry, and when the air is currently full of dampness, it can not soak up any more, which slows down the drying procedure.

The influence of moisture on your painting project can be much more significant if you are repainting in a badly aerated location, as the dampness in the air will certainly have nowhere to go, and will certainly simply linger around your job, making the drying time even longer.

The best way to battle the effects of moisture on your painting project is to select a day when the weather is dry, or to repaint throughout a time of day when the moisture is reduced, such as very early in the morning or later in the evening. Additionally, you can utilize a dehumidifier or a fan to help circulate the air and speed up the drying time.

How Extreme Temperatures Can Modify Paint Consistency



When it gets also hot or chilly, it can cause your paint to become thicker or thinner, making it tougher to use smoothly. Extreme temperature levels can cause the paint to lose its consistency and influence the way it complies with surfaces.

If it's also warm, the paint may dry out as well rapidly, leaving visible brush marks or roller strokes. On the other hand, if it's as well cool, the paint could not dry at all, leading to a sticky and irregular finish.

To avoid paint uniformity troubles triggered by extreme temperature levels, it's crucial to pick the right time of day to paint. Early morning or late afternoon, when the temperature is not too expensive or also reduced, can be the very best time for paint.

Below are some suggestions to help you select the best climate condition for your paint task:



- Examine the weather prediction: Prior to starting your project, see to it to check the weather forecast for the following couple of days. Avoid paint on days with high humidity or solid winds, as these conditions can affect the paint's bond and drying out time.

- Aim for modest temperatures: Extreme temperatures can influence the consistency of the paint and trigger it to dry as well quickly or not at all. Aim for temperatures between 50 and 85 degrees Fahrenheit for ideal paint problems.
